Mother and son die in fatal fire

Blaze occurred in early hours of Sunday morning.

Two people have died following a fatal fire at a house in the Ballyjamesduff area last night.

A mother, aged in her 80s, and her son, aged in his 50s, are understood to have perished in the blaze, which happened at around 2am on Sunday, September 10.

Emergency services from Ballyjamesduff attended the scene at Lackenmore, in a rural area between Ballyjamesduff town and New Inns.

Gardaí are still at the scene this morning, and a full investigation is pending. The scene is currently being preserved for a technical examination

The bodies of both deceased have been taken to the mortuary at Cavan General Hospital, where a post-mortem is due to take place.

A spokesperson for An Garda Siochana confirmed to the Celt: "Gardaí were alerted to a fire at a domestic residence in Ballyjamesduff, Co. Cavan shortly before 2.00am on Sunday morning, 10th September 2023.

"Fire Services attended the scene and extinguished the fire.

"A woman (aged in her 80s) and a man (aged in his 50s) were pronounced deceased at the scene. The bodies of the deceased have been taken to the mortuary at Cavan General Hospital where a post-mortem will take place in due course."

They added: "The scene of the fire is currently preserved for a technical examination by the Garda Technical Bureau. The Coroner has been notified. Enquiries are ongoing."

Fine Gael councillor Trevor Smith described what happened as a "terrible tragedy", and said that the "thoughts and prayers of the whole community are with the family, their relatives and friends at this difficult time".
